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
50 67239787191 25 67078899430 793935727
75487468250 449719703 155
75487468250 449719703 155
441 402942 44
All about undefined
Interested in learning more?
75487468250 449719703 155
441 402942 44
See more
17642331 803 6497
13627235863 31312091425 1112634695 46652581283 4378
See more
284 18
757678805 7007 083
See more